Shuai Qin is a leading researcher at the intersection of industrial automation and environmental economics, whose work has profoundly shaped our understanding of how technology can drive sustainable manufacturing. His most-cited study, "Does industrial robot application promote green technology innovation in the manufacturing industry?" (2022), has garnered 344 citations, establishing a foundational link between robotics adoption and eco-innovation. In this seminal work, Qin demonstrates that the integration of industrial robots not only boosts productivity but also significantly accelerates green technology development by reducing waste and enabling cleaner production processes. This research has become a cornerstone for policymakers and industry leaders seeking to align automation with environmental goals.
